Modi refuses scarf offered by Muslim

Ahmedabad, October 20: Gujarat Chief Minister Narendra Modi refused to entertain a printed scarf offered to him by a Muslim in Gujarat’s Navsari district. Modi accepted the normal shawls from visitors but refused to entertain a printed scarf offered by a Muslim.

The incident is a repeat of the one which occurred at Ahmedabad when he had refused to put on a ‘skull cap’ offered by a Muslim cleric during his sadbhavana fast. At that time, the Imam had offered Modi a ‘skull cap’, but he politely refused to wear it, asking him to offer a shawl instead. The Imam had then raised a hue and cry and said that Modi had insulted his religion.
